You definitely have a problem in the flyback supply, including the horizontal output stage. You have already proven that the CRT is not loading it down. Voltage checks should reveal the cause. Have you checked the B+ BOOST voltage? Since you have two voltages that are low, each supplied by separate windings on the flyback through separate rectifiers, I think the problem is more likely to be in the horizontal output & damper circuits. Have you swapped those tubes?
